Star Wars (1977) 7
Star Wars 7 is the seventh issue of the Legends comic book series Star Wars. It was co-written by Roy Thomas and Howard Chaykin, with art by Chaykin and Frank Springer, and it was first published by Marvel Comics on October 11, 1977. The issue features the story "New Planets, New Perils!," which was the series' first story set after the events of Star Wars: Episode IV A New Hope.

Plot summary
After bidding farewell to their Rebel friends, Han Solo and Chewbacca set out to return to Tatooine to pay off their debt to Jabba the Hutt. En route, they are hijacked by space pirate Crimson Jack and his gang of thugs. The pirates take the reward money given to Han and Chewbacca by the Rebel Alliance for rescuing Princess Leia Organa but spare their lives.
Forced to lay low because they cannot pay Jabba, the two seek refuge on the planet Aduba-3. There they are hired by Pera, a priest of the Sacred Way, to bury a recently deceased borg. Although they meet with some resistance from the locals who object to having a borg buried in their traditional mound, they do eventually find their way to the burial site. After completing that task, the two smugglers are relaxing in a local cantina, where they are presented with a much deadlier job.
Development
The issue had a shipping date of September 13, 1977,[3] an on-sale date of October 11, 1977, and a January 1978 cover date.[1]
Continuity
Star Wars 7 features the story "New Planets, New Perils!," which was one of the first installments of what eventually became the Star Wars Expanded Universe.[3] It introduces the characters Crimson Jack and Jolli, who are recurring characters in the series.[4][5]
